Basketball Preview: Hazelwood Central Hawks vs. East St. Louis Flyers
The Hazelwood Central Hawks will be home for the holidays to greet the East St. Louis Flyers at 5:30 p.m. on Wednesday. The teams are on pretty different trajectories at the moment (Hazelwood Central has three straight victories, East St. Louis has four straight defeats), but none of that matters once you're on the court.
Last Thursday, even if it wasn't a dominant performance, Hazelwood Central beat Nerinx Hall 51-45.
Meanwhile, East St. Louis came up short against Collinsville on Thursday and fell 58-45. While losing is never fun, the Flyers can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Illinois basketball rankings (they are ranked 340th, while the Kahoks are ranked 117th).
Hazelwood Central's win was their third stra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 4-2. The wins came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 53.0 points per game. As for East St. Louis, their loss dropped their record down to 2-6.
Hazelwood Central didn't have too much breathing room in their game against East St. Louis in their previous meeting back in December of 2018, but they still walked away with a 49-45 victory. Does Hazelwood Central have another victory up their sleeve, or will East St. Louis tur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
